The project involves two "V" shaped gas transmission pipelines to be located in the US and Mexico. The lines will begin in south Texas and intersect in the Burgos Hub area of Mexico, near a new gas storage field being developed in the region.
Sonora Pipeline, a wholly owned subsidiary of Tidelands Oil and Gas, will construct and operate the US portion of the pipeline project, and Tidelands' corporate affiliate, Terranova Energia, will construct and operate the Mexican portion.
